Were seeking a detail-oriented reliable Payroll Specialist to join our team part-time. Reporting to the VP of People Experience and Talent this role will be responsible for ensuring accurate and timely processing of payroll maintaining compliance with federal state and local regulations and supporting employees with payroll-related inquiries. Youll also collaborate with HR and Finance to support process improvements and maintain high standards of accuracy and confidentiality.
Key Responsibilities
Process bi-weekly payroll accurately and on time ensuring compliance with federal state and local regulations
Maintain payroll records and manage wage garnishments child support orders and tax levies in accordance with legal requirements
Handle state tax registration and ensure proper setup and compliance across applicable jurisdictions
Respond to employee inquiries regarding payroll deductions and timekeeping with accuracy and professionalism
Collaborate with HR and Finance teams to ensure accurate payroll reporting reconciliation and cross-functional support
Assist with year-end reporting including preparation of W-2s tax filings and other required documentation
Support internal and external audits by providing timely and accurate payroll documentation
Required to perform other duties as requested directed or assigned
Requirements and Qualifications
Associates or Bachelors degree in Accounting Finance Human Resources or a related field preferred
3 years of payroll processing experience ideally in a multi-state environment
Strong knowledge of payroll practices wage and hour laws and tax regulations
Experience with payroll software (ADP Paylocity Workday or similar)
Proficient in Microsoft Excel and other Microsoft Office applications
High level of accuracy attention to detail and confidentiality
Excellent communication and problem-solving skills
Ability to work independently manage priorities and meet deadlines
